10 ways to make £1000 a month in the UK


Freelance work

If you have skills in writing, graphic design, web development, or any other field, consider offering your services as a freelancer. Freelance work can be done from anywhere and allows you to work on your own schedule. There are many freelance platforms such as Upwork and Freelancer that connect freelancers with clients.


Virtual tutoring

If you have expertise in a subject, consider offering virtual tutoring services. You can offer your services to students around the world through online tutoring platforms such as Tutorful and MyTutor. Virtual tutoring is a flexible and rewarding way to earn extra money.


Online surveys

There are many websites that pay you to take surveys online. Although they won't make you rich, they can provide a steady stream of extra income. Some popular survey sites in the UK include Swagbucks and Toluna.


Affiliate marketing

If you have a blog, website or social media following, consider affiliate marketing. Affiliate marketing is when you promote other people's products and earn a commission for every sale made through your unique affiliate link. Amazon Associates is one of the most popular affiliate programs in the UK.


Sell products online

If you have a talent for crafting or creating, consider selling your products online. Etsy is a popular online marketplace for handmade goods, while eBay and Amazon also offer opportunities for selling products. You can also create your own online store using platforms like Shopify.


Rent out a room

If you have a spare room in your home, consider renting it out on Airbnb or other short-term rental platforms. Renting out a room can provide a steady stream of extra income, especially if you live in a popular tourist destination.


Online teaching

If you have experience in teaching, consider offering your services as an online teacher. Platforms like Teachable and Udemy allow you to create and sell your own courses. You can also offer your services as a language tutor on platforms like Italki.


Dog walking and pet sitting

If you love animals, consider offering dog walking or pet sitting services. There are many pet owners who need someone to take care of their pets while they are away or at work. Platforms like Rover and Tailster connect pet owners with pet sitters and dog walkers.


Rent out your car

If you have a car that you don't use frequently, consider renting it out on platforms like Turo. Turo allows car owners to rent out their cars to others for a fee. This can be a great way to earn extra income if you don't use your car often.


Delivery driving

If you have a car, you can also earn extra income by becoming a delivery driver. Platforms like Deliveroo and Uber Eats allow you to deliver food to customers in your area. You can also sign up to be a driver for ride-hailing services like Uber or Lyft.
